小程序是一种轻量级的应用程序,由于其易于传播和快速运行的特点,在各个领域都得到了广泛的应用。在小程序的开发过程中,前端开发人员需要掌握一些基本的技能,其中之一就是如何修改CSS。本文将介绍小程序中如何修改CSS。
一、CSS的基本概念
CSS(Cascading Style Sheets)是层叠样式表的缩写,用于定义HTML、XML等文档的呈现方式。CSS可以掌控一个网页中各个元素的显示效果,比如背景颜色、字体样式、元素的大小、位置以及间距等。在小程序中,也可以使用CSS来掌控各个组件的样式。
二、小程序中如何修改CSS
小程序中的CSS主要通过两种方式进行修改:全局的CSS样式以及局部的CSS样式。
全局的CSS样式是指可以影响所有组件的样式。在小程序中,可以在app.wxss文件中定义全局的CSS样式。这个文件只有一个,其中可以包含各种CSS样式的定义。
在app.wxss文件中,首先需要声明所有的CSS样式:
/* app.wxss */ @import "wxss文件的路径"; /* 定义CSS样式 */ 样式名称 { 样式属性: 属性值; }
这里需要注意的是,在小程序中,CSS样式的定义需要加上单位。比如元素的高度可以写为“50px”或“10rpx”,而颜色可以直接写英文单词或使用16进制值。
在定义完所有的CSS样式之后,我们可以在其他wxss文件中引用app.wxss中的样式:
/* index.wxss */ @import "/app.wxss"; /* 使用CSS样式 */ .page { font-size: 30rpx; background-color: #ffffff; }
在这个例子中,我们首先将app.wxss文件引入了index.wxss文件中,然后就可以在page节点中使用其中定义的样式了。
局部的CSS样式是指只影响某个组件的样式。在小程序中,每个组件都可以使用自己独有的class来定义CSS样式。我们可以在wxml文件中,通过定义class属性,并在相应的wxss文件中定义对应的CSS样式来实现局部的CSS样式修改。
比如:
<!-- index.wxml --> <view class="page">Hello, world!</view>
/* index.wxss */ .page { font-size: 30rpx; background-color: #ffffff; }
在这个例子中,我们在view组件中定义了class属性,并把其设置为“page”。然后在index.wxss文件中,定义了与该class对应的CSS样式。
三、总结
通过上面的介绍,我们了解了在小程序中如何修改CSS样式。在实际开发中,小程序中的CSS样式可以帮助我们实现各种丰富的界面效果。祝大家在小程序开发中取得更好的成果!
以上是小程序怎么修改css的详细内容。更多信息请关注PHP中文网其他相关文章!